Do not be scared to turn down social invites if you are pregnant and not feeling well. The people close to you will understand. You may become tired or sick. Do not force yourself to do anything you are not up to.

Keep every single one of the appointments you have with your medical care provider in order to stay one step ahead of any situation that may develop. These appoints are scheduled at certain times during the pregnancy so your doctor can view the progress of the fetus, and to also monitor your body. In an effort to know your health is being maintained, keep your appointments.

When pregnant, you should eat roughly 300-500 additional calories per day. You will need to feed your baby and combat your fatigue with extra food. Try to eat food that is healthy, such as vegetables and fruits.

Have someone else pump your gas during your pregnancy. Gas fumes can cause harm to your baby. It is much better to ask for help than put yourself at risk.

It is important that a pregnant woman stays away from stress, as much as she can. Too much stress may pose a variety of problems, not only to the woman, but also to the baby she is carrying. Extreme stress can sometimes bring on premature birth.

Bland and low tasting food, such as crackers, are an ideal foodstuff to eat during the day while pregnant. Crackers and other bland foods can keep you from feeling nauseous while also easing your body’s desire for less healthy food choices. Greasy and acidic foods are best avoided, as they can exacerbate nausea and trigger heartburn.

Decorating the nursery can be exciting. But, keep in mind that you should not be around paint fumes when pregnant. If you are going to paint, open your windows to ensure that the room is properly ventilated. You should have loved ones around to assist you and to do the harder tasks.

It isn’t always wise to give in to the often, constant cravings associated with pregnancy. Your unborn child needs to receive good nutrition through what you eat. If you gorge yourself on unhealthy foods, you are depriving your baby of much-needed vitamins and nutrients.

Stretching your legs before you go to sleep can help you avoid leg cramps in the middle of the night. Most pregnant women experience leg cramps. Stretching prior to bed can help your muscles relax and prevent that middle of the night wake-up.

Start giving yourself soothing belly massages as you approach the third trimester. Rest against two pillows on a bed or couch so that your body is in a comfortable position. Take oil, not a lotion, and lightly massage it into your stomach. Breathe deeply, and add some relaxing music. This will help you relax, and it will also soothe the baby.
